The Olives c 1872 by Samuel White Sweet - State Library of South Australia, B 10747

The Olives was designed by Edmund William Wright for his brother Edward. The avenue from High Street to the house was bordered by tall kaffir apple trees.
In the early 20th century the house was owned by Mr and Mrs Alfred Roberts. They gave parties for interstate and international tennis players. Mr Roberts O.B.E. was Mayor of Glenelg from 1899 to 1902 and again from 1915 to 1917.
